  4. On 11/14/2019 at 1:18 AM, maxmp said:

    When Poweramp Settings / Audio / Direct Volume Control (DVC) / No DVC for Bluetooth Absolute Volume option is disabled, Poweramp doesn't touch bluetooth at all. Please note that is not related to your end device (car headunit), but to your phone/Android version you have, so no extra recommendations can be given without that info.

    There are similar "No DVC" options per Audio Output - those are not related to bluetooth.
